Recreational drug use
Use of psychoactive drugs for pleasure or pastime.
Recreational drug use is the use of one or more psychoactive drugs to induce an altered state of consciousness, either for pleasure or for some other casual purpose or pastime. When a psychoactive drug enters the user's body, it induces an intoxicating effect. Recreational drugs are commonly divided into three categories: depressants (drugs that slow down the central nervous system), stimulants (drugs that speed up the central nervous system), and hallucinogens (drugs that induce perceptual distortions). In popular practice, recreational drug use is generally tolerated as a social behaviour, rather than perceived as the medical condition of self-medication. However, drug use and drug addiction are severely stigmatized everywhere in the world.

Lore & Background
Many researchers have explored the etiology of recreational drug use. Some of the most common theories are: genetics, personality type, psychological problems, self-medication, sex, age, depression, curiosity, boredom, rebelliousness, a sense of belonging to a group, family, and attachment issues, history of trauma, failure at school or work, socioeconomic stressors, peer pressure, juvenile delinquency, availability, historical factors, and/or socio-cultural influences. There has been no consensus on a single cause. Instead, experts tend to apply the biopsychosocial model. Any number of factors may influence an individual's drug use, as they are not mutually exclusive. Regardless of genetics, mental health, or traumatic experiences, social factors play a large role in the exposure to and availability of certain types of drugs and patterns of use. According to addiction researcher Martin A. Plant, some people go through a period of self-redefinition before initiating recreational drug use. They tend to view using drugs as part of a general lifestyle that involves belonging to a subculture that they associate with heightened status and the challenging of social norms. Plant states: 'From the user's point of view there are many positive reasons to become part of the milieu of drug taking. The reasons for drug use appear to have as much to do with needs for friendship, pleasure and status as they do with unhappiness or poverty. Becoming a drug taker, to many people, is a positive affirmation rather than a negative experience.' Anthropological research has suggested that humans 'may have evolved to counter-exploit plant neurotoxins'. The ability to use botanical chemicals to serve the function of endogenous neurotransmitters may have improved survival rates, conferring an evolutionary advantage. A typically restrictive prehistoric diet may have emphasized the apparent benefit of consuming psychoactive drugs, which had themselves evolved to imitate neurotransmitters. Chemical–ecological adaptations and the genetics of hepatic enzymes, particularly cytochrome P450, have led researchers to propose that 'humans have shared a co-evolutionary relationship with psychotropic plant substances that is millions of years old.'

The severity of impact and type of risks vary widely with the drug in question and the amount being used. Alcohol is sometimes considered one of the most dangerous recreational drugs. Alcoholic drinks, tobacco products and other nicotine-based products (e.g., electronic cigarettes), and cannabis are regarded by various medical professionals as the most common and widespread gateway drugs. Some scientific studies in the early 21st century found that a low to moderate level of alcohol consumption, particularly of red wine, might have substantial health benefits such as decreased risk of cardiovascular diseases, stroke, and cognitive decline. This claim has been disputed, specifically by British researcher David Nutt, who stated that studies showing benefits for 'moderate' alcohol consumption in 'some middle-aged men' lacked controls for the variable of what the subjects were drinking beforehand. Experts in the United Kingdom have suggested that some psychoactive drugs that may be causing less harm to fewer users are cannabis, psilocybin mushrooms, LSD, and MDMA; however, these drugs have risks and side effects of their own. Drug harmfulness is defined as the degree to which a psychoactive drug has the potential to cause harm to the user and is measured in several ways, such as by addictiveness and the potential for physical harm. Responsible drug use advocates that users should not take drugs at the same time as activities such as driving, swimming, operating machinery, or other activities that are unsafe without a sober state. In efforts to curtail recreational drug use, governments worldwide introduced several laws prohibiting the possession of almost all varieties of recreational drugs during the 20th century. The 'war on drugs' promoted by the United States, however, is now facing increasing criticism. Evidence is insufficient to tell if behavioral interventions help prevent recreational drug use in children.

A Co-Evolutionary Heritage
Anthropological research points to a far older relationship between humans and psychoactive plant chemicals than most people realize. Scientists have proposed that humans may have evolved specifically to counter-exploit plant neurotoxins, meaning the ability to metabolize and harness botanical chemicals that mimic endogenous neurotransmitters likely conferred a survival advantage in prehistoric environments. A restrictive prehistoric diet may have made the apparent benefits of consuming psychoactive substances especially valuable. The genetics of hepatic enzymes, particularly the cytochrome P450 family, along with broader chemical-ecological adaptations, support the hypothesis that humans share a co-evolutionary relationship with psychotropic plant substances stretching back millions of years. In this framing, the human body's capacity to process and respond to external psychoactive compounds is not an accident or a modern vulnerability but a deeply embedded biological trait shaped by long-term selective pressures in the natural world.
Harm, Risk, and the Ongoing Debate
The health consequences of recreational drug use vary enormously depending on the specific substance, the dose, the user's individual physiology, and environmental factors. Alcohol, tobacco, and cannabis are frequently cited by medical professionals as the most widespread gateway drugs, with initial use in the United States, Australia, and New Zealand most commonly occurring during adolescence in middle and secondary school settings. The question of whether any recreational drug carries net benefit remains contentious. Some early-21st-century studies suggested that low to moderate alcohol consumption, particularly red wine, might reduce cardiovascular risk, stroke, and cognitive decline. British neuropsychopharmacologist David Nutt challenged these findings, arguing that the studies lacked proper controls for what subjects had consumed beforehand. Meanwhile, UK experts have suggested that among controlled substances, cannabis, psilocybin mushrooms, LSD, and MDMA may cause relatively less harm to fewer users, though each still carries its own distinct risks and side effects. The concept of drug harmfulness—measuring the degree to which a psychoactive substance can damage its user—remains a complex, multi-dimensional assessment.
